Al'san

"Al'san is a land of great forests & mountains that have darkened the sky when the mortal races have angered the land. It is a place of both great beauty and despair."
  Al'san is a harsh landscape that rewards any who can survive here. Known as the land of Fire & Stone, the continent is littered with mountains and volcanoes that have created fertile lands and hardy flora. At the heart of the continent lies a string of mountains known as the Red Spires. Beneath these mountains is said to be the lair of Sur'yo, who sleeps deep beneath the mountain in its fiery heart.    

Geography

The Western Marshes

To the west of the Red Spires lies marshlands that spread in all directions for miles. Sparsely populated by the Samru, the marshlands are home to all manners of life, those born on the land and those below the surface. It's believed that during Vin'mahsa, Ko'fur battled against Var'kahn and ravaged the lands with great winds and rain. During their struggle Ko'fur froze the wind and rain as the two gods continued to battle. Hv'ala would eventually come to Var'kahn's aid and threw the very mountains of the land at Ko'fur until he ran away. Over time the land would thaw from the heat of the mountains until a vast marshland remained.

The Heartlands

East of the marshlands lies a river that separates the marsh from the fertile lands that sit in the shadow of the Red Spires. Known as the Heartlands, this region possesses volcanic soil that has sustained the Samru since they first came to these lands. Further south great forests surround the two great lakes of the region. The northern one is known as Petal Lake and feeds into the southern larger lake known as Lake Umbra. Over time the Samru would establish an empire here that would last for over a thousand years.

The Southern Shores

South of Lake Umbra lies the Southern Shores. The volcanic soil gives way to lush grasslands and forests. Still in reach of the northern winds the land remains cold until one reaches the coast. Here the warmer southern winds clash with the cold winds of the north bringing great thunderstorms to the land. With frequent thunderstorms, these shores have long been believed to be the original home of Var'kahn, the Embodiment of Thunder. It is said the battle between Var'kahn and Ko'fur took place as Ko'fur had promised the lands to the Vis'hala. Many years after Vin'mahsa, the Stilhe would travel to these lands and clear out the Vis'hala from their holds, one by one.

The Shallows

The Shallows are a series of islands south of the Al'san mainland that are loosely connected by shallow waters. Many ships have run aground not knowing the few deep-water shipping lanes of the area. However the ships can be easily freed when the tides turn at Shipwreck Straights push back water into the shallows. Many of the lesser houses of the Travgin Empire have established cities on these islands. These lesser houses often took the name of their house from the waters surrounding their islands.
